About the area
Rochester, Minnesota, may be renowned as the home of the world-famous Mayo Clinic, but this Midwestern city offers much more than just top-notch medical care. It's a destination that combines charm and culture, providing visitors with a variety of experiences.
For those interested in medical history, the Mayo Clinic itself is a fascinating place to visit. The Mayo Clinic tours offer insights into the institution's history and contributions to medical science. The Plummer Building, with its historic architecture and the iconic Plummer House, provides a glimpse into the lives of the clinic's founders.
Beyond its medical heritage, Rochester is a hub for the arts. The Rochester Art Center showcases contemporary art exhibitions, while the city's thriving music scene can be enjoyed at the Chateau Theater or during the summertime with the outdoor concert series, Thursdays on First & 3rd. The city also hosts the Rochester International Film Festival, which draws cinema enthusiasts from all over.
For outdoor lovers, Rochester doesn't disappoint. Quarry Hill Nature Center features hiking trails, a pond, and a nature center that's perfect for families. Silver Lake Park offers paddleboat rentals and picturesque picnic spots. In the winter, the area transforms into a wonderland for cross-country skiing and ice skating.
Rochester's culinary scene is diverse, with farm-to-table restaurants, cozy cafes, and international cuisine reflecting the city's multicultural community. The city's farmers market is a treasure trove of local produce, artisanal foods, and handcrafted goods.
Shopping in Rochester is another highlight, with a mix of unique boutiques, antique shops, and the Apache Mall, the largest shopping center in the region. For those seeking relaxation, the city offers several spas where visitors can unwind and rejuvenate.
